World Record Status update from GNAS

We have just had a phonecall from GNAS and they have confirmed that Kirby Muxloe is the only club to have WRS withdrawn and that all other clubs have retained WRS. An official announcement is expected on the GNAS website soon but they have said this information is to go into the public domain.

It will affect all WRS events at KM which will now be UK record status. Unfortunately they will not count for ranking or qualification scores.

According to GNAS, all other clubs have been able to meet FITA requirements for a WRS shoot.

It is a shame they could not have worked around it like other clubs have. We know that last year all-carbons were shot at KM without issue.

I raised the issue of all-carbon arrows at the 98 venues selected for the 2012 practice as many of these are multi-use fields. My understanding from the conversation this morning is that this was not considered and it is something they are now going to look at.
